“The State must help to promote and encourage production. … There must be none of that shrinking from national organization, national production, and national assistance. Germany never made that mistake. Take the most important of national industries, agriculture. Agriculture in the past has been overlooked in this country. It has been neglected, with the result that we have been dependent very largely on lands across the seas for our food. We have realized during the war the perils of this position. … It is in the highest interests of the community that the land in this country should be cultivated to its fullest capacity, and I doubt whether there is a civilized country in the whole world where agriculture has received less attention at the hands of the State. … The cultivation of the land is the basis of national strength and prosperity.”
Speech in Manchester (12 September 1918), quoted in The Times (13 September 1918), p. 8
